State of Mind with Maurice Benard is a leading mental health podcast dedicated to open conversations about emotional wellness and resilience. Hosted by Emmy Award–winning actor and New York Times bestselling author Maurice Benard (Nothing General About It: How Love (and Lithium) Saved Me On and Off General Hospital), the show explores every aspect of mental health, from bipolar disorder and anxiety to everyday struggles with purpose, relationships, and hope. Through honest, heartfelt discussions with guests from all walks of life, State of Mind reminds listeners that no matter what you’re going through—you’re not alone.

  • AJ Mendez / AJ Lee on WWE, Bipolar Disorder, and and Making Peace With “Jean”
    Jun 18 2026

    AJ Mendez, known to WWE fans around the world as AJ Lee, returns to State of Mind and has a deeply honest and powerful conversation Maurice. They talked about growing up tough, surviving pressure, living with bipolar disorder, and returning to the wrestling spotlight with a healthier sense of self.

    AJ opens up about her childhood, her mother’s mental health journey, hospitalization, therapy, routine, and the tools that help her separate herself from dark thoughts. She also shares why she named the darker side of her bipolar disorder “Jean,” how she learned to manage anxiety before stepping back into the ring, and why support, treatment, and self-awareness look different for everyone.

    For lifelong WWE fans, this is a rare look at the person behind AJ Lee. For anyone navigating their own mental health journey, it is a reminder that a diagnosis does not have to define you. With the right tools, support, and honesty, what feels like a weakness can become part of your strength.

    In this episode, Maurice and AJ discuss bipolar disorder, wrestling, anxiety, depression, WWE, mental health support, creative work, marriage, storytelling, and why living with a mental health condition can become a superpower.

  • Joshua Benard on Music, Mental Health, and Turning Pain Into Art
    Jun 16 2026

    Maurice Benard welcomes his son Joshua Benard back to State of Mind for a deeply personal conversation about music, acting, anxiety, depression, family, and the creative life.

    After a powerful performance at The Hotel Cafe, Joshua opens up about finding his identity as a songwriter, moving from songs rooted in pain to music that also makes room for joy. He and Maurice talk honestly about sleep, depression, bipolar disorder, what it feels like to watch a parent struggle with mental health, and why openness can be both necessary and complicated.

    The conversation also moves into creativity, performance, artistic influences, acting versus music, Chris Martin’s unforgettable advice to “don’t stop,” and Joshua’s perspective on pain as something that cannot always be measured or ranked. The episode closes with an intimate live acoustic performance from Joshua.

  • Andrew Hawkes Opens Up About General Hospital, Mental Health & the Gift of Staying Alive
    Jun 6 2026

    Maurice Benard welcomes Andrew Hawkes from General Hospital for a raw and heartfelt conversation about acting, anxiety, addiction, depression, family, and survival. Andrew shares how undiagnosed ADD shaped his childhood, how acting gave him focus, and how recovery, therapy, and love helped him find gratitude after some of the darkest seasons of his life. A deeply human episode about staying alive long enough to discover what life still has waiting for you.
